A Launching Gantry is: • Mechanized steel structure • Designed for the erection of precast concrete bridge

1.1 COMPOSITION

The Launching Gantry is composed of 4 main elements: - Main Trusses (MT) (2 nos.) - Universal Lower Roller Support (ULRS) (4 nos.) - Lower Cross Beam (LCB) (2 nos.) - Propping system (Prop’s & Base Frame) (2 nos.)

1.2 FUNCTIONS - MT: Structural element that supports the

segments

- ULRS: Main support of the MT. It adjusts

the position of the MT

- LCB: Transfers the load from the ULRS to

the propping system

- Propping system: Transfers the load from

the LCB to the pier foundation

2.1 BRIEF & DESIGN

Brief • Max. span weight = 900 Tons • Lmax = 46.32m • 6% cross-fall & 6% gradient • Perform Self Launching

Design • Main Truss (MT) • Universal Lower Roller Support (ULRS) • Lower Cross Beam (LCB) • Propping system

2.6 MEOP & COMMISSIONING

MEOP (Major Equipment Operation Permit): Internal Quality Procedure

It ensures: • The correct set-up of equipment and operating systems • The competence of management and operators • Implementation of best practices

What are the steps ?

1) Review of Personnel (CVs)

2) Review of Equipment

3) Review of MS & ITP

4) Review of Trainings

Conducted by ?

VSL Senior personnel from the operations, technical and quality/safety/environment teams

2.6 MEOP & COMMISSIONING

Structure Testing: What are the steps ?

1) Loading of the LG

2) Measurement of the deflection

3) Close control/inspection of the whole structure

NOH3 – Load Test

Equipment Testing: What are the steps ?

1) Testing of all electrical items

2) Testing of all hydraulic items
